This book traces the ancestry of Walter Allen, an immigrant who settled in Newbury, Massachusetts in 1640, and whose descendants populated much of New England. The author begins by establishing Walter Allen's English origins in the early 17th century and places him within the context of the Puritan migration to the New World. Through careful research and family records, the book follows Allen's descendants for many generations, detailing their lives, marriages, and migrations throughout the American colonies. The book explores the diverse paths taken by Allen's descendants, from farmers and laborers to doctors, lawyers, and soldiers, providing insights into the social and economic history of New England.
